How scars become hypertrophic
After closure, collagen is deposited and then remodelled over roughly a year. Where deposition outpaces remodelling, the scar becomes raised, firm and often itchy or painful — hypertrophic, or keloid where growth extends beyond the original wound margins.
Two modifiable factors influence that balance: hydration of the outer skin layer, which moderates fibroblast signalling, and mechanical tension across the wound, which stimulates further collagen production.
What silicone does
Silicone gel and sheeting occlude the scar surface and maintain hydration of the stratum corneum. The effect appears to be mediated by that hydration and occlusion rather than by any pharmacological action, and it is recommended in international scar-management guidance as a first-line non-invasive option for both prevention and treatment.
Gels suit mobile areas, the face and irregular contours; tapes and sheets suit flat sites and can add gentle tension control.
Protocol and adherence
Therapy generally starts once the wound is fully closed and dry, and continues for at least two to three months — longer for scars that remain red, raised or symptomatic. Daily wear time matters more than product choice.
Because outcomes hinge on months of consistent use, comfort, skin tolerance and simplicity of application are the practical determinants of success.
